Abstract

The utility model discloses a Z-shaped electrode of a special relay of an electric energy meter. The Z-shaped electrode comprises a relay body, a first electrode and a second electrode, and is characterized in that the first electrode and the second electrode respectively extend to and are mounted in both ends of the relay body; the first electrode is provided with a current divider and has a Z-shaped structure; and the current divider on the first electrode is parallel to the relay body. The Z-shaped electrode provided by the utility model is simple in structure and safe in use, and can greatly lower the interference of an external electromagnetic field on the electric energy meter.

Background technology
Relay is in automation field, to use and a kind of widely electronic devices and components, electromagnetic relay, electromechanical relay that the intelligent ammeter of China adopts, and its shunt electrode adopts inverted L shape or in-line more, is parallel to the ammeter drain pan; This makes adjacent lines or external electromagnetic field be easy to the metering of electric energy meter is caused interference, causes the shunt running of ammeter, causes puzzled and trouble for user and electric company.
